Bad Proton Mail UX
Proton Mail has multiple glitches that significantly reduce the practical utility of this email service.
- After years, Proton refuses to persist the Unread filter across inbox refreshes, new Web browser tabs, and application relaunches. Gmail does NOT have this unnecessary UX problem. My first experience opening Proton Mail immediately upsets me, every time.
- Sending emails often takes many, many seconds to complete, compared to other email services. Sending emails with Proton Mail feels sluggish.
- After several months of using Proton Mail, I discovered that dozens of my emails hadn't actuall been sent, they had all been stuck as drafts. This breaks down communciation with people I need to communicate with reliably.
- The Drafts section really needs a counter displaying the number of unsent messages. To highlight the fact that messages weren't actually sent.
- Bulk delete operations on drafts don't actually process. A page refresh shows the same drafts are still there.
Instead of cosmetic reskins, please just fix any of the hundred bugs in this platform.
